Analysis
The most recent figure for other β emissions (co2eq) from n2o in Land Locked Developing Countries (LLDCs) is 10,083 kt, measured in 2023.
Compared with earlier readings it is down 1.2% on the previous year and up 8.1% over ten years.
Over the whole period, other β emissions (co2eq) from n2o in Land Locked Developing Countries (LLDCs) peaked at 10,454 kt in 2021 and was at its lowest, 641.01 kt, in 1961.
The series is highly variable year to year, so single readings are best treated with caution.
Averages by decade
| Decade | Average | Lowest | Highest | Years |
|---|---|---|---|---|
| 1960s | 652.99 kt | 641.01 kt | 665.3 kt | 9 |
| 1970s | 966.92 kt | 883.88 kt | 1,070 kt | 10 |
| 1980s | 4,698 kt | 1,136 kt | 6,222 kt | 10 |
| 1990s | 8,014 kt | 6,276 kt | 9,229 kt | 10 |
| 2000s | 8,889 kt | 7,724 kt | 9,827 kt | 10 |
| 2010s | 9,654 kt | 8,825 kt | 10,367 kt | 10 |
| 2020s | 10,174 kt | 9,951 kt | 10,454 kt | 4 |

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
